Transaction 713f937389537384352415223225f9a375ab65a29acc250ca03d88123e4e6125
1 Input
1 Output
-
713f937389537384352415223225f9a375ab65a29acc250ca03d88123e4e6125:0
- value
- 381655145
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c5a613db40274f387e4dceff61a8be85b1c8465 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16W7pDHHirzcqcBNMzEdCkgcnjDQmyyK9C